A reusable launch vehicle is a type of launch vehicle that is designed to be launched more than once, significantly reducing launch costs and making space access more accessible. These vehicles are built to return to Earth without sustaining damage, or they may have retrievable stages that can be reused in future launches, creating a more cost-effective approach to space transportation.

The main types of reusable launch vehicles are partially reusable launch vehicles and fully reusable launch vehicles. Partially reusable launch vehicles allow for the reuse of specific components, typically the first stage, resulting in overall launch cost savings of 30% to 40%. Reusable launch vehicles can be configured for different orbits, such as Low Earth Orbit (LEO) and Geosynchronous Transfer Orbit (GTO), and they are classified based on their payload capacity, including multiple weight categories such as up to 6,000 lbs, 6,000 to 10,000 lbs, and over 10,000 lbs. These vehicles can be configured as single-stage or multi-stage rockets. Applications for reusable launch vehicles span both commercial and defense sectors.

The reusable launch vehicle market size has grown rapidly in recent years. It will grow from $2.27 billion in 2024 to $2.51 billion in 2025 at a compound annual growth rate (CAGR) of 10.6%. The growth in the historic period can be attributed to cost reduction, space industry expansion, spaceport infrastructure, environmental considerations, space debris mitigation.

The reusable launch vehicle market size is expected to see rapid growth in the next few years. It will grow to $3.73 billion in 2029 at a compound annual growth rate (CAGR) of 10.4%. The growth in the forecast period can be attributed to increased payload capacity, global spaceports, government space programs, satellite internet networks, interplanetary exploration. Major trends in the forecast period include space tourism boom, commercial satellite mega-constellations, rapid turnaround, global launch competition, heavy-lift reusability.

The growth of the reusable launch vehicle market is anticipated to be driven by the increasing number of satellite launches. Satellite launches involve sending satellites into space, and the use of reusable launch vehicles can significantly reduce the associated costs. According to the Government Accountability Office's report in September 2022, there are nearly 5,500 active satellites in orbit, with an estimated additional 58,000 launches expected by 2030. This surge in satellite launches is a key factor propelling the growth of the reusable launch vehicle market.

The expanding space economy is expected to drive the growth of the reusable launch vehicle market in the future. The space economy encompasses various economic activities and industries associated with space exploration, development, and utilization. A growing space economy fosters an environment conducive to the development and increased use of reusable launch vehicles, making space more accessible and cost-effective for diverse applications. For example, in April 2024, the World Economic Forum, a Switzerland-based non-governmental organization, projected that the space economy will reach $1.8 trillion by 2035, driven by advancements in space-enabled technologies. Additionally, in July 2024, the Space Foundation, a US-based non-profit organization, reported that the global space economy grew by 7.4% to $570 billion in 2023, with commercial revenues hitting $445 billion, which represents 78% of the total. Thus, the expanding space economy is propelling the growth of the reusable launch vehicle market.

A notable trend in the reusable launch vehicle market is the emphasis on technological advancement. Major companies in this sector are focusing on developing technologically advanced reusable launch vehicles to maintain their competitive edge. For example, ArianeGroup, a France-based aerospace company, launched Susie (Smart Upper Stage for Innovative Exploration) in September 2022. Susie is a versatile and modular vehicle designed for space tasks, featuring a large internal bay suitable for transporting payloads or crewed flights. This technological innovation aims to enhance reuse opportunities and reduce operational costs in the reusable launch vehicle market.

Strategic partnerships are playing a crucial role in the development and utilization of reusable launch vehicles. Major companies in the market are entering into strategic partnerships to advance the accessibility and cost-effectiveness of space travel. In August 2023, iRocket, a US-based reusable small launch vehicle manufacturer, partnered with the Air Force Research Laboratory (AFRL). This collaboration provides iRocket exclusive access to a test facility at Edwards Air Force Base, allowing for joint efforts on reusable rocket development. The $18 million project includes the construction of test stands, engine testing, and a demonstration launch.

In August 2023, Vector Acquisition Corporation, a US-based financial services firm, merged with Rocket Lab. This merger aims to enable both companies to support future space application activities by providing data and services from space, along with further organic and inorganic growth in the Space Systems ecosystem. Rocket Lab is a US-based manufacturer of reusable launch vehicles.
